Product Introduction
The Woodward 9907-1183 Digital Governor is a state-of-the-art electronic governor designed for precise and reliable control of diesel and gas engines. It offers advanced engine speed regulation to optimize performance, improve fuel efficiency, and reduce emissions. This governor is widely used in power generation, marine, and industrial applications where consistent engine speed and load sharing are critical.
The 9907-1183 model features digital processing for smooth and fast response to load changes, with customizable settings and diagnostics to support maintenance and operational efficiency. Its rugged construction ensures long-term reliability even in harsh operating environments.
Product Specifications
| Parameter | Specification |
|---|---|
| Product Name | Woodward 9907-1183 Digital Governor |
| Model Number | 9907-1183 |
| Control Type | Digital electronic governor with PID control |
| Power Supply | 12 V DC or 24 V DC |
| Output Type | Analog output (4-20 mA), PWM, or stepper motor control |
| Input Signals | Engine speed, load feedback, setpoint input |
| Operating Temperature | -40°C to +85°C |
| Storage Temperature | -55°C to +90°C |
| Humidity | 0 to 95% non-condensing |
| Mounting | Panel or base mounting with vibration isolation |
| Dimensions (W × H × D) | 242 × 185 × 62 mm |
| Weight | 1.8 kg |
| Communications | Optional Modbus RTU serial communication |
| Certifications | CE, UL, CSA |
